> how can i change the defaultrouter in a nonglobal zone without
> changing it in the global zone? /etc/defaultrouter doesn't work, i
> can't add a route in a nonglobal zone and i can't add a route in the
> global zone only for the non-global zone.

There is no mechanism (yet) to do that.  Non-global zones don't have
their own kernel forwarding tables, and only the global zone can
manipulate shared resources such as the kernel forwarding table.

See CRs 4991139 and 6289221.

